The Challenge
The client's IT portfolio of applications and projects had grown at an
enormous rate, introducing the challenge to manage multiple IT initiatives
and align IT investments with business objectives and stakeholder
priorities.
Existing systems used by the client (Project Management and Human
Resource Management), provided very little information about the
numerous IT initiatives in progress throughout the organization. The
business metrics, that demonstrate the value produced by IT investments,
were unobtainable. The client recognized that without the right controls,
processes and systems in place, the organization would continue to
struggle to assess the value, cost, risk and performance that IT delivers.
The existing IT infrastructure could not support the increased demand for
new IT initiatives and a new management platform was desired to capture
real-time IT status.
The Solution
Automation of the software development life cycle and maintaining
efficiency in project management, quality management and release
management are critical for managing IT value.
Patni recommended the implementation of Mercury's IT Governance
suite and Informatica's data warehousing solutions. In addition, Patni reemphasized
the need for interoperability between the IT governance
solution, Project Management and Human Resource Management
solutions in order to achieve business goals.
Once approved, Patni lead the design and implementation of the new IT
management platform and new IT status reporting system. This new
solution delivers real-time IT status, delivering accurate information on
time to enable difficult IT portfolio decisions to be made with
confidence.
The Technology
 |
Application Server: Mercury Kintana Application server |
 |
Data warehousing Tool: Informatica |
 |
Web Server: iPlanet |
 |
Back end: Oracle8i |
 |
OS: Sun Solaris |
 |
Programming: PL/SQL, UNIX scripts |
